SEGA has unveiled SEGA Football Club Champions 2025, a new cross-platform football management sim coming to P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, PC (Steam), iOS, and Android. Launching worldwide in 2025, the game will be free-to-play, with closed beta sign-ups available now via the official website.

Built on the foundation of the Football Manager series, SEGA Football Club Champions 2025 puts players in control of a small local club, tasking them with leading their team to global success.
The game features two primary modes:
- Career Mode: Build and manage a team over time, make tactical decisions, and grow your club into a powerhouse.
- Dream Team Mode: Compete online in PvP formats, including Event Matches, Arena battles, and custom Room Matches.
The title includes 10,000 real-world footballers to scout and sign, with over 1,500 players from Japan’s J1 to J3 leagues, alongside official athletes from FIFPRO, the K League, Manchester City F.C., and more through SEGA’s global licensing partnerships.
